If you’re operating as a sole trader, rather than a limited company, you don’t need to register with Companies … WebSole trader meaning. Sole traders own their entire business as individuals. It means, as a sole trader, you have 100% control of the business, its assets, profits and also its liabilities. WebBeing a sole trader appeals to a wide range of people, including: tradespeople, eg plumbers, house painters and electricians. contractors who work for other organisations, eg IT consultants and builders. small business owners, eg hairdressers and landscape gardeners. people who turn a hobby into a business, eg artists and furniture makers.
